Top, Jacket, Pants, And Headscarf
This is a Top, jacket, pants, and headscarf. It was designed by Barjis Chohan and made for Barjis.
This object is not part of the Cooper Hewitt's permanent collection. It was able to spend time at the museum on loan from Fine Arts Museums of San Francisco as part of Contemporary Muslim Fashions.
Barjis Chohan’s faith guides her ethical and sustainable business practice, which includes fair wages, equal opportunities, the use of eco-friendly materials, and a stance against the objectification of men and women and distorted ideas of beauty. Her hand-painted and hand-drawn prints are the focus of the brand.
